Transaction e06dd30b3eb765eef75b6c2e5f9de8a5fa826e247708caa28ebab819243f268b
1 Input
1 Output
-
e06dd30b3eb765eef75b6c2e5f9de8a5fa826e247708caa28ebab819243f268b:0
- value
- 3953525
- script pubkey
- OP_0 OP_PUSHBYTES_20 6366ad1c382d5f6a773d3775b6157c35a1ced9fc
- address
- bc1qvdn268pc940k5aeaxa6mv9tuxksuak0uyygzgx